Given a compact complex manifold X, we study the existence and the uniqueness of weak solutions to degenerate Monge-Ampère equations on X with prescribed singularities when the reference form is semipositive and big, while the right hand side is a non-pluripolar positive Radon measure. This generalizes our previous work to more general hermitian manifolds and also to the case of solutions with prescribed singularities.
